Fibre Mood - ROSEMARY Skirt Sewing Pattern

When it comes to Rosemary, less is more. This simple mini skirt with darts at the front and back has a subtle A-line and a waist neatly finished with a facing. Perfect for braving a sun-drenched day. And about that zip: choose a closed-end zip for thicker fabrics and go for a concealed zip if you are using something lighter.

Sizes: 4 - 32

Skill level: Advanced Beginner 2/5

Materials & Supplies 

• Thread

• Iron-on interfacing: max. 30 cm

• Closed-end zip: 18 cm (for thick fabrics)

• Concealed zip: 22 cm (for thin fabrics)

• Fabric: see table

Fabric suggestions 

Rosemary likes fabrics with some body. Cotton twill, denim, (imitation) leather and (ribbed) velvet, poplin, polycotton, linen, and woven jacquard are good options. Make sure your fabric isn't too thin or too lightweight.
